Transaction 64049c15511203cce8f290fc733d8be015ba4b31d83dfbba0052be9cf27a8521

3 Input
2 Outputs
  • 64049c15511203cce8f290fc733d8be015ba4b31d83dfbba0052be9cf27a8521:0
  • value  980000
    address  31itnx3HA2PP711zR3JGMah1hk5eDkSsyg
  • 64049c15511203cce8f290fc733d8be015ba4b31d83dfbba0052be9cf27a8521:1
  • value  666041
    address  3J4QJeiDtgAvs9NWXXsvEsVAYngmiEMzQd